Palamangalam is a village panchayat in Narayanavanam mandal in Chittoor district of Andhra Pradesh, India.

Features

  • A famous lord Shiva temple is situated in this village.
  • Major crops are groundnut and sugarcane.
  • Ethanol production factories are only 2 in Andhra Pradesh, out of two one of them is in Palamanagalam named as 'Amman Bio Pharmacy Pvt Ltd'.
  • In Chittoor District, there are 5 sugar factories, one is constructed in Palamangalam 'Prudential Sugar Corporation'.
